Asa is one of the Nigerian artistes that has not compromised the quality of her music over the years. Though we believe we change with times, she only upgraded her production and quality - not trying to impress us by producing club banger like the rest of the musicians now do. You can easily find someone singing nonsense make sales and rise to fame because of the beat of his song rather its content.
